Leak Rates

Leak Rates

Table 2 gives the conversion between various commonly used leak rate (or throughput) units that are used to define how 'leak tight' an assembly or a part is. To check hardware is suitable for use, helium leak detectors are used. Helium is applied to the vacuum seals and/or joints, and the detector displays a leak rate which can be checked against the specification for that assembly or part. 


All Concept Vacuum parts and assemblies are helium leak tested to check their suitability for vacuum applications.
